Iroquois administrators present balanced $61.25M budget and set May 19 vote
Summary
District business administrator John Wolske presented a balanced $61,248,130 budget that assumes a 1% foundation-aid increase from the state and relies on the district's 2.12% tax-levy limit; the board will hold a budget hearing and the public vote is set for May 19.
John Wolske, the district's business administrator, presented the proposed 2026 budget to the Iroquois Central School District board, saying the plan is balanced at $61,248,130 and that the administration closed an approximately $600,000 gap through spending adjustments and turnover planning.
